The search for a person missing from a boat in Auckland's Manukau Harbour is expected to continue at first light.

On Tuesday night Coastguard said two people on a boat got into difficulty near Puketutu Island.

One person swam back to shore and alerted police, but the other was still missing.

The boat was towed back to shore on Tuesday night. Coastguard said the search ended for the night.

Police confirmed they responded to a distress call at 5.50pm.

"Another person is believed to still be missing in the water."

Coastguard volunteers from Titirangi and Papakura were involved in the search.

Coastguard said the search conditions on Tuesday night were challenging due to the swell and darkness.

"But our volunteers that are out on the water on three rescue vessels are committed to doing all they can to try find the missing person."

Auckland Airport's hovercraft and Westpac Rescue Helicopter also earlier assisted in the search.
